This book is a philosophical analysis of knowledge in practices,
focused on knowing how, tacit knowledge and expert knowledge.
Knowing in action is the key concept. It covers understanding,
well-functioning routines as well as successful learning processes.
It is argued that knowledge-in-action is more basic than
propositional or theoretical knowledge. Key notions are knowing as
a kind of attentiveness or a way of being in the world, knowing as
continued learning, and knowledge as what leads people in the best
way. The book is a contribution to the contemporary philosophical
discussions about knowing how, tacit knowledge and expert
knowledge. At the same time, it is written as an interdisciplinary
and case-based introduction to the epistemology of knowing and
learning.
